Roger L'Estrange, Fables of Æsop and Other Eminent Mythologists… (1692)
“ Here's a Case of Honour, and of Conscience, Both in One, upon the Matter of Hospitality, and of Trust. The Laws of Hospitality are Sacred on the One Side, and so are the Duties we Owe to our Country on the Other. If we Consicer the Trust, Faith must not be Broken; If the Common Enemy, his Councel is not to be kept. The Wood Man did as good as Tacitly promise the Fox a Santuary ”
